Review Physics, Applied

Double-atom catalysts for energy-related electrocatalysis applications: a theoretical perspective

Donghai Wu et al.

Summary: Atomically dispersed metal catalysts have attracted intensive research attention due to their excellent activity, selectivity, and stability. Recently, double-atom catalyst (DAC) with a metal dimer anchored on a substrate has emerged as a research focus for energy-related electrocatalysis reactions. DACs offer more possibilities to adjust geometrical configurations and electronic structures due to the flexible dual-metal sites and the synergetic effect between the two metal atoms. This review summarizes the theoretical research on DACs for diverse energy-related electrocatalytic reactions and highlights how their outstanding attributes affect reaction pathways, catalytic activity, and product selectivity.

Article Chemistry, Physical

Adsorption of SF6 decomposition gases (H2S, SO2, SOF2 and SO2F2) on Sc-doped MoS2 surface: A DFT study

Baoliang Li et al.

Summary: In this study, the adsorption behaviors of four typical SF6 decomposing gases on MoS2 and Sc-MoS2 surfaces were investigated using density functional theory. It was found that Sc-MoS2 has excellent adsorption properties for SO2, SOF2, and SO2F2, but weak adsorption for H2S. The introduction of Sc atom as the active center significantly enhanced the adsorption effect for target gases.
